We had about 35 fish Friday... fortunately, only 4 fish under 3 pounds. I've been on the lake maybe 6 times since opening. So far... we've caught them up to 7 lbs with most being in the 4 1/2 pound range and a lot of 5's. It is great to see fish so fat and healthy. However, when that lake got hot... it shut down. I need to learn the deep, deep water bite there.
The creek channels leading into main lake have held some nice fish for us.We seem to get on groups of bigger fish, catch a few... then it turns off and we move. Friday... we got on a nice flipping bite, caught some good size stuff in 1 foot very tight to cover.
